Athenian Figure-Decorated Pottery for Whom? A View from Eastern Andalucía (Spain)

Athenian pottery began to arrive in the Iberian Peninsula in significant quantity in the fifth century BCE, with a peak in the fourth century. Both black-gloss and figure-decorated pots were exported, the former being markedly the more common in all the Iberian regions but one: eastern Andalucía.
